The first PlayStation introduced unforgettable experiences that laid the groundwork for modern gaming. Titles such as Final Fantasy VII, Metal Gear Solid, and Resident Evil showed that video games could be cinematic, emotional, and complex. These weren’t simple diversions—they were epic adventures that pushed hardware limits and player imagination. The PlayStation 2 continued this momentum, becoming home to legendary titles like Shadow of the Colossus, Gran Turismo 3, and Kingdom Hearts. Its success was not just measured in sales but in its ability to connect with people emotionally, fostering an entire era of gaming culture built around discovery and storytelling.
As technology advanced, so too did the ambition of PlayStation’s developers. The PlayStation 3 and PlayStation 4 generations gave rise to titles that blurred the line between cinema and interactive art. The Last of Us, Uncharted 4, and Bloodborne weren’t just best-sellers; they were emotional milestones that deepened the narrative potential of gaming. Sony’s focus on exclusive titles gave players reasons to stay loyal to the platform, cementing PlayStation’s reputation as a haven for creativity and storytelling excellence.
Today, with the PlayStation 5, that legacy continues stronger than ever. The new generation’s best games—Horizon Forbidden West, Demon’s Souls Remake, and Spider-Man: Miles Morales—showcase not only technical brilliance but emotional depth.
